- ベストアンサー
エクセルの条件付き書式で祝日の文字を赤字にする方法は?
- エクセルの条件付き書式で祝日の文字を赤字にする方法を教えてください。
- 条件付き書式の中で数式を使用して、祝日のセルを赤字にする方法を試していますが、うまくいきません。
- また、祝日のリストが長くなると手入力が面倒なので、10年分の祝日をリスト化する方法も知りたいです。
- みんなの回答 (4)
- 専門家の回答
質問者が選んだベストアンサー
その他の回答 (3)
- imogasi
- ベストアンサー率27% (4737/17069)
祝日に条件付き書式を使って色(セルや文字色)をつけるには 祝日の具体的なデータをシートに作る必要があります。その日付は、日付シリアルで作る必要があります。またそれらは式で表せるようなものでなく、人間が 作成しておかなければならず、毎年同じ月日とは限らないのは、「国民の」常識です。 この祝日テーブルを作るのが面倒なので、何とかしたいという質問かな。 その辺質問の意図がよくわからない。しかし祝日表には限りがあるから、何年か先には見直す必要があるという面倒さはぬぐえない。 WEBなどに載っている、具体的な祝日日付の情報をコピペするしかないが、文字列になってしまうだろう。この文字列なら、それを日付シリアル値にしておいた方がよく、エクセル関数で変換してテーブルを作る手はある。 ー 今考えているセルの日付(通常日付シリアル値で考えるが。この点明確にしてないのは、初心者的だ。)が祝日表に該当があるか、の判定は、COUNTIF関数やVLOOKUP関数(FALSE型)やMATCH関数が使えると思う。 それらの関数式は、条件付き書式の「新しいルール」の「数式を利用して・・」のところでTRUEかFALSEの決定に使う。
- masnoske
- ベストアンサー率35% (67/190)
COUNTIF関数を使えば良いと思います。 =COUNTIF(範囲, 検索条件)>0 範囲は休日の日付リストのセル($B2:$B19 みたいな感じ) 検索条件はカレンダーの日付が入っているセル(G3 みたいな感じ) 日付リストの中に検索条件の日付があれば、1が返ってきます。
- Nobu-W
- ベストアンサー率39% (725/1832)
yahoomodeさまの望むのとは違いますが、休日一覧よりその指定日に色を付 けるという方法の参考までに、下記サイトを読んでみて下さい https://kokodane.com/2013_kan_063.htm 少し変えれば、お望みのものが作れると思います (*^^*) がんばって素敵なカレンダ~作って下さいっ ちなみに・・・参考までに (^o^) http://calendar.infocharge.net/cal/2020/ 祝日一覧サイトありますので、エクセルにコピペすれば楽ですよ^^ 2023年までありますが、新たに祝日ができたりすると更新されます
お礼
一番参考になりましたありがとうございます